Dick Casali is entering his 8th season as the Rams head volleyball coach.  In his first seven seasons on the bench, the Rams have made six appearances in the MASCAC Volleyball Tournament and advanced to the finals once. In 2006 Coach Casali guided the Rams to their first appearance in the ECAC New England Volleyball Championship Tournament.  Over his first seven seasons at the helm, Casali has led the Rams to an impressive 108 wins and .524 winning percentage.  Coach Casali is IMPACT and CAP II certified for coaching. 

In 2010, Casali guided the Rams to their first 20 win season since 2001 and reached the 100 win coaching milestone on September 4th as the Rams defeated Suffolk University.  He is the first FSU volleyball coach to achieve 100 wins on the bench and is one of only two active FSU coaches to achieve 100 wins with the Rams. 

Prior to joining the Framingham State coaching staff, he was an assistant volleyball coach at Dean where he also coached softball.  During Coach Casali's time at Dean they won two Region 21 titles and in 2006 played for the National Softball title.  Coach Casali, who is also a graduate of Framingham State, coaches volleyball for the MetroWest Juniors as well as at Saint John's High School.
